There is a fantastic new exhibition at the Victoria and Albert Museum, London – The Fabric of India. It is packed full of mathematical information for your students to explore. It is on from 3 October 2015 until 10 January 2016. Wonderful for understanding how spectacular embroidered patterns are created.

There are plenty of accompanying video clips too. Did you know that red dye techniques were known to the Indus Valley civilisation about 45000 years ago? And that cotton has been cultivated for 9000 years? Or that ‘ari” hook embroiderers from Gujurat, India, were highly prized by the Mughal and European courts?
